Human Resources for Health Specialist

3 months ago


Abuja, Nigeria The Health Strategy and Delivery Foundation HSDF Full time

ROLE PURPOSE

The Human Resources of Health HRH Specialist will provide strategic direction, technical leadership, and oversight to the HRH component of the project. This will include strengthening leadership and governance, workforce performance improvement, evidence-based human resource planning, strengthening recruitment, deployment and retention practices; health education and health workforce regulation. S/He will ensure a comprehensive approach to human capacity development and provide programmatic leadership to ensure seamless planning, implementation of activities, and technical support. S/he must have an appropriate balance of technical, managerial, and interpersonal skills and experience. The HRH Specialist will have the capacity to successfully interact with national and sub-national ministries and agencies, development partners, civil societies, and community-based organizations. S/he has technical expertise and prior experience in HRH program implementation, and more specifically human resource management and performance improvement and experience working with USAID projects. Furthermore, a deep understanding of the health system in Nigeria, both at the national and sub-national level, is essential.

  • The HRH Specialist will act as a strategic advisor to the relevant government counterparts in all reforms and policy considerations related to HRH in Nigeria. Responsibilities include leading and ensuring technical quality assurance for the relevant knowledge products and deliverables; contributing to strategic thinking for the project; and offering coaching and mentoring to government counterparts to institutionalize improvements in HRH improvements.
  • S/He will be accountable for project deliverables, results, implementation, and ongoing monitoring of the project activities related to HRH, including fulfillment of technical strategy and vision, effective project and people management, comprehensive documentation, and reporting, and fostering stakeholder relationships related to HRH.

RESPONSIBILITIES

  • Provide strategic guidance on HRH initiatives within the project activities and oversee project technical workstreams and activities in areas such as HRH capacity, workforce improvement, evidence-based planning, advocacy, research, and technical assistance.
  • S/He will develop and nurture working relationships with senior level government leadership.
  • Collaborate with the chief of party and team to develop and implement HRH strategies aligned with USAID requirements.
  • Strengthen the capacity of national and sub-national government stakeholders to provide oversight of and effectively engage with local government health teams on HRH reforms, capacity and improvement.
  • Strengthen the capacity of local partner institutions on HRH management, recruitment, and retention, and related areas.
  • Provide technical support to the Ministries and health teams to apply HRH management to incentivize providers to improve the quality of care.
  • Collect, collate, and analyze routine data on selected indicators to inform the development of appropriate HRH interventions related to NHIA, public financial management, and financing of primary health care, access to commodities and supplies, and UHC.
  • Support Ministry/sub-national-level monitoring, evaluation, learning, and reporting activities on HRH management, including technical and operational oversight of regional referral hospital and/or local government-level activities.
  • Develop and ensure high-quality of all major deliverables and work products such as reports, briefs, summaries, presentations, and other documents in a timely manner as expected.
  • Document and disseminate learning products on HRH management and improvements to different stakeholders to inform policy. Use the learnings and emerging evidence to co-create sustainable HRH solutions with Ministry and LGAs.
  • Lead a team or support/supervise analytical work and HRH and workforce development analysis in areas potentially including but not limited to service delivery, staffing, recruitment, and workforce regulation, and the development of HRH reforms, policies, and plans.
  • Supervise mid-level technical staff to achieve project milestones within the anticipated project timeline.
  • Work in a facilitative manner with national counterparts from government, civil society, and other stakeholders, to support local leadership, decision-making, and capacity strengthening.

QUALIFICATION AND EXPERIENCE

The requirements listed below are representatives of the knowledge, skills and/or ability required to successfully perform this job:

Experience/Expertise

  • Masters degree in public health, public policy and management, business, or other relevant field
  • Excellent command/proficiency in English
  • Five to seven 5-7 years relevant work experience in public policy, health workforce management, or health system strengthening in Nigeria or similar context.
  • Significant understanding and knowledge of healthcare strategies, challenges, and opportunities within the Nigerian context
  • Demonstrated analytical skills related to health workforce management.
  • Demonstrated ability to engage effectively with external strategic partners, donors, government ministries, and stakeholders.
  • Strong facilitation, problem solving, and stakeholder engagement skills.
  • Eagerness to support and mentor junior staff and peers.
  • Ability to produce new evidence and translate evidence into policies.
  • Outstanding cross-cultural communication skills, including the ability to relate respectfully with staff at all levels, ages, genders, nationalities, and orientations and across work areas.
  • Excellent research and analytic skills, communication skills verbal, written, and presentation.
  • Excellent organizational and time management skills
  • Ability to work both independently and as a member of a team and to handle multiple priorities is required.
  • Experience working with implementing partners at international, regional and national levels.
  • In-depth knowledge of USAID approaches and regulations
  • Strong interpersonal skills with demonstrated ability to lead and work effectively in team situations.
  • Proven ability to complete projects according to outlined scope, budget, and timeline.
  • Preferred: Strong, existing relationships with the Government of Nigeria, Ministry of Health and USAID.
